![]() This brief shows that improvements to risk management processes in Maldives can be replicated in other domestic organizations and similar environments across South Asia. Risk management is a systematic approach to determine which goods and passengers need to be examined in detail when entering a country. It involves (i) collecting, storing, and analyzing data to understand the risk profile of goods and passenger luggage; (ii) using risk profiles to assess the likelihood of illicit trade activity; and (iii) addressing risks by inspecting consignments and responding to illegal activity. Maldives is implementing reforms to improve risk management controls and to strengthen its trade environment. Recent activities to facilitate trade and safeguard its borders seek to deliver operational and economic gains in the public and private sectors. Government agencies are working to improve service delivery and, at the same time, to leverage limited human and financial resources more efficiently. Traders, in turn, will benefit from reduced time to import and export goods, increased predictability of services, and greater ease of doing business. Key Points
